Understanding Female Turkeys: Hen Behavior & Roles

Female gobblers exhibit a fascinating behavior that's often overlooked compared to their male counterparts. While males are known for their impressive displays, ladies play key roles in this flock's longevity. Their chief responsibilities include sitting on eggs , raising young, and diligently scouting sustenance . Analysis of lady behavior reveals subtle interactions within the flock, and they frequently show dominance in safeguarding the young ones from predators . Furthermore, hens contribute to maintaining turkey alive harmony within a turkey community .

White Turkeys: Rare Beauty or Genetic Fluctuation ?

The striking sight of a white turkey often captures attention, leading many to believe them a representation of rare grace . However, generally , these birds, known as "white turkeys," are primarily the result of a straightforward {genetic anomaly affecting coloration production. While their distinctive appearance certainly can be enjoyed, it’s vital to acknowledge that they aren’t a separate species but rather a instance of natural {genetic variation within the turkey population . More study continues to examine the specific genes involved in this color trait , adding depth to our knowledge of avian biology.

Turkey Life Cycle: From Tiny Chick to Majestic Creature

The turkey life cycle is a fascinating journey, beginning with a miniature egg . Incubation requires approximately {28 | four weeks ) days, after which a hatchling breaks free . These newborns are totally dependent on their hen for care and sustenance. Growth is fast initially, with hatchlings doubling in size within merely a few days . Juvenile birds acquire to forage for grubs , kernels, and greenery. As they age, they reach their full plumage and commence their purpose in breeding . Ultimately , the tom exhibits his striking presence, and the cycle begins anew.

  • Initial Stage : Egg and Hatching
  • Early Life : Chick maturation & maternal protection
  • Adolescence : Learning foraging techniques
  • Full Development: Covering appearance and Breeding

Identifying Female Turkeys: Key Characteristics

Distinguishing ladies from gobblers can seem tricky, but several key characteristics assist in identification. Generally, females are significantly less large than their masculine counterparts, often weighing roughly half as much . Their covering is typically a dull color, providing superb camouflage, unlike the bright colors of toms . Observe their beard ; hens possess a far shorter or absent beard, while gobblers boast a prominent one. Finally, note for vocalizations; hens tend to produce softer noises compared to the boisterous gobbles of gobblers .
